What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an entry level systems engineer?

To thrive as an Entry Level Systems Engineer, you should possess a solid understanding of computer hardware, networking, operating systems, and typically hold a bachelor's degree in engineering, computer science, or a related field. Familiarity with tools like Linux/Unix, scripting languages, virtualization platforms, and foundational certifications such as CompTIA Network+ or Cisco CCNA is often valued. Strong problem-solving abilities,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help set candidates apart. These competencies are crucial for diagnosing system issues, working with cross-functional teams, and supporting complex IT environments.

What does an entry level systems engineer do?

A typical day for an Entry Level Systems Engineer often involves monitoring system performance, assisting with troubleshooting technical issues, and supporting more senior engineers on larger infrastructure projects. You might work on tasks such as configuring servers, running diagnostics, updating documentation, or implementing routine maintenance. Collaboration is common, as you'll interact with IT support teams, software developers, and network administrators to resolve problems and improve system reliability. Expect a blend of hands-on technical work, learning opportunities, and regular communication with team members to ensure smooth IT operations.

What is an entry level systems engineer?

An Entry Level Systems Engineer is responsible for assisting in the design, development, testing, and maintenance of system infrastructure and applications. They work under the guidance of senior engineers to ensure system performance, security, and reliability. Typical tasks include troubleshooting technical issues, supporting system integrations, and documenting processes. This role requires foundational knowledge in systems engineering, problem-solving skills, and familiarity with programming or networking concepts. It is often an entry point for those pursuing careers in IT, software, or hardware engineering.

The Effector RF Design Department is seeking talented engineers with the skills and passion to develop complex Radio Frequency (RF) systems, subsystems and components, including antennas, RF circuit card assemblies, radomes, and RF test-equipment. A successful candidate is one who functions in a multi-disciplined team, properly applies engineering tools and processes, and is a self-motivated problem solver with a positive attitude and willingness to learn. This is an entry-level Mechanical Engineer position for an individual with educational experience and professional interest in the application of technical mechanical standards, principles, concepts, and techniques. This position is located in Tucson, AZ and is an onsite role. What You Will Do * Collaborate in a multi-discipline team setting to solve complex engineering problems
* Create 3D CAD models and engineering drawings for RF products designs
* Develop prototype hardware designs and coordinating fabrication
* Perform hands on integration and test support for prototype hardware
* Hold design and drawing reviews with peers and subject matter experts Qualifications You Must Have * Typically requires a Bachelor's in Science, Technology, Engineering, or Mathematics (STEM) and a minimum of 2 years of prior relevant experience to include any combination of the following:
* Experience performing design and analysis for the packaging of RF products (e.g. Circuit Card Assemblies, antennas, radomes, RF test equipment, harnesses and interconnects) throughout the product life cycle to include three dimensional (3D) Computer Aided Design (CAD) software
* Experience with creation of Technical Data Packages (TDPs) using Geometric Dimensioning and Tolerancing (GD&T) for products
* Ability to obtain INTERIM U.S. government issued security clearance is required prior to start date with the ability to obtain special program access after start. Qualifications We Prefer * Master of Science (MS) in mechanical engineering or electrical engineering
* Experience with 3D CAD design (preferably Creo Parametric).
* Experience in antenna and/or electronics packaging.
* Experience with harness and interconnect design.
* Experience creating engineering drawings.
* Experience fabricating prototype designs.
* Familiarity with the application of Geometric Dimensioning & Tolerancing (GD&T).
* Experience working collaboratively in a multi-discipline team.
* Experience performing tolerance analysis.
* Self-motivated problem solver with a positive attitude and willingness to learn.
